I echo Tom's concearns about the smaller seed, the "points" of the kernel protruding out the hole can be a problem. We have ran cyclo air's of varying vintage 800, 900, 955 since the mid 90's, we really had never had a problem until this year, we planted some extremely large plateless, had a tough time keeping the cells of the drum filled during its rotation. Medium flats or Medium flat large (MFL in the old Garst system) work the best for us.
